Hi,

This is a topic you can into a lot of detail about however to put it simply, the reason we do ablution(wudu) is because God has made this a condition before we pray:

"O you who believe! When you prepare for prayer wash your faces and your hands (and arms) to the elbows; rub your heads (with water); and (wash) your feet to the ankles" [Qur'an 5:6]

Now what causes one to enter into a state of impurity is what the Prophet Muhammad(SAW) has taught, examples include passing wind and going to the bathroom.

So the verse above indicates that our prayers are not accepted without being in a pure state. When one is going to stand in front of the Creator of the whole universe we have to and should want to be in a pure clean state, its even recommended we smell nice.

However aside from it being something we have been commanded to do, it also has many benefits in this world, im sure you can think of those, when it comes to keeping clean and hygiene. However they also benefit us in the afterlife, example:

Abu Hurairah (RA) reports that Muhammad(SAW) said "When the Muslim (or 'Believing') servant makes wudoo and washes his face then the sin of everything he looked at with his eye comes away with the water, or with the last drop of the water, and when he washes his hands then the sin of everything he stretched out his hands to comes away with the water, or with the last drop of the water. And when he washes his feet every sin which his feet walked towards comes away with the water or with the last drop of the water - so that he leaves clean (clear/pure) from sins. [Muslim].

among the reasons mentioned above, its also about going through a mental preparation before prayer.

It is said of Ali ibn al-Husayn that he used to turn pale when he made his ablution. When his family asked what came over him during his ablution, he would say, 'Do you realize before whom I wish to stand in prayer?'

Source: Inner Dimensions of Islamic Worship, Al-Ghazali pg.30

As well, due to this ablution, there is a hadith, that says the areas that were washed will glow on the Day of Judgment and the Prophet (saw) will recognize his people through their glowing bodt parts, which is a result of ablution.
